Ecocem delivers Exegy ultra-low CO2 concrete to Edmonton EcoPark

Written by Global Cement Staff 11 January 2022
  • Print

UK: Ecocem has reported the successful delivery of the first batch of its Exegy ultra-low CO2 concrete at the site of the upcoming EcoPark South waste management hub at Edmonton EcoPark in London. Infrastructure construction company Taylor Woodrow carried out the work. Ecocem says that Taylor Woodrow used Ecocem Ultra concrete from the new Exegy range, reducing the carbon footprint of the project’s concrete by 70%.

Ecocem says that it has secured contracts for the supply of Ecocem Ultra concrete to the sites of the upcoming Grand Paris Express transport link and Paris Athletes’ Village in Paris in Paris, France.
